O PNG é ótimo para gráficos, mas péssimo para fotos — o tamanho dos arquivos aumenta muito. Converta fotos PNG para JPG e mantenha 95% da qualidade visual com apenas 10% do tamanho do arquivo.
ou arraste e solte sua imagem aqui.
Suporta JPG, JPEG, PNG, WEBP, SVG, GIF, HEIC, HEIF, BMP, TIFF, HDR, JP2, RAF, PSD, CR3, DNG, APNG, AVIF, AVI, ESP, EXR, J2C, J2K, JXL, PFM, PNM, PPM, PSB, SGI, MPEG, PDF
Arraste e solte arquivos PNG na ferramenta — arquivos individuais ou em lote. Por padrão, os PNGs transparentes são achatados sobre um fundo branco (configurável).
Os pixels decodificados passam por um codificador JPEG com qualidade 90. O conteúdo fotográfico é comprimido de 8 a 12 vezes; os gráficos com cores sólidas são comprimidos com menor eficiência.
Os arquivos de saída mantêm os nomes dos arquivos de origem com a extensão .jpg. Resultados típicos: um PNG de 4 MB se torna um JPG de 400 a 600 KB sem nenhuma diferença visível.
Converter imagens entre estes conversores relacionados
Convert PNG to JPG for better compatibility and optimization
Improved file compatibility and optimized performance
Professional-grade conversion with quality preservation
excellent for photos with advanced JPG encoding
Perfect for photography, web images, social media
Handles lossless compression, transparency support, crisp graphics from PNG files
a codificação ocorre na sua aba, não em nossos servidores.
converter mais de 50 fotos PNG em uma única operação.
Gráficos planos devem ser mantidos em PNG. Fotos geralmente devem ser em JPG.
Portable Network Graphics
Requires libpng-1.0.11 or later, libpng-1.2.5 or later recommended. The PNG specification does not support pixels-per-inch units, only pixels-per-centimeter. To avoid reading a particular associated image profile, use -define profile:skip=name (e.g. profile:skip=ICC).
Joint Photographic Experts Group JFIF format
Note, JPG is a lossy compression. In addition, you cannot create black and white images with JPG nor can you save transparency. Requires jpegsrc.v8c.tar.gz. You can set quality scaling for luminance and chrominance separately (e.g. -quality 90,70). You can optionally define the DCT method, for example to specify the float method, use -define jpeg:dct-method=float. By default we compute optimal Huffman coding tables. Specify -define jpeg:optimize-coding=false to use the default Huffman tables. Two other options include -define jpeg:block-smoothing and -define jpeg:fancy-upsampling. Set the sampling factor with -define jpeg:sampling-factor. You can size the image with jpeg:size, for example -define jpeg:size=128x128. To restrict the maximum file size, use jpeg:extent, for example -define jpeg:extent=400KB. To define one or more custom quantization tables, use -define jpeg:q-table=filename. These values are multiplied by -quality argument divided by 100.0. To avoid reading a particular associated image profile, use -define profile:skip=name (e.g. profile:skip=ICC).
Gerenciamento de transparência, configurações de qualidade e quando não converter.